About Bluem Sock:

Bluem Sock is 75% British Bluefaced Leicester wool/25% nylon, spun at a local mill and hand-dyed by Susan here at Monkley Ghyll.

Bluem sock is a Fingering weight yarn, worsted spun with a high twist making it perfect for socks. The Bluefaced Leicester yarn is a soft but resilient fibre and combined with a small amount of nylon, it creates the perfect fabric for socks. The yarn shows off texture, cables and lace to great effect and the fibre combination takes colour beautifully.

All shades are limited edition and dyed by hand here at Monkley Ghyll in a range of shades inspired by the landscape on this hillside farm.

 

400 metres/437 yards per 100g.
100 metres per 25g.

 

Recommended gauge from 28-34 sts to 10cm (4in) using 3.25-2.25mm needles.

 

Also available in 25gm mini-skeins.
